It was bestowed on the Acadiana heartland town with a little help from native son Bob Angelle, a longtime state legislator who was Speaker of the House in 1958 when Breaux Bridge was on the cusp of its centennial anniversary -- and the moniker has become an anchor of the city's touristic and cultural identity. "Some crawfish had been double-cropped with rice for at least half a decade, and state wildlife biologist Percy Viosca Jr. had been preaching crawfish farming since the 1930s, but it was these latest state efforts that provided the impetus to expand the industry, " Pitre states.
